There are four main goals of point and level systems: 1) increasing appropriate behavior; 2) promoting academic achievement; 3) fostering a student’s improvement through self-management; and 4) developing personal responsibility for social emotional and academic performance (Farrell, Smith & Brownell, 1998). A point system or token economy involves awarding ("reinforcing") tokens, chips, stickers, check marks, points, stars, or other items/markings to students who demonstrate desired behaviors identified by the teacher.
